The 2020 McNab delivers wonderful complexity and elegance, with round, full fruit and age-worthy structure. The nose offers a basket of sweet purple, blue and black berries scented with vanilla bean and a touch of summer bramble. The palate bursts with blue fruit and plums braided with fragrant mocha, cedar, cloves, pepper, savory herbs and pencil lead. Tightly-woven oak tannins support the wine through its long finish of mint tea and black fruits.

McNab Ranch is the agricultural heart of Bonterra Biodynamics. Named for McNab Creek, a tributary of the Russian River and steelhead spawning ground, this 371-acre property was transformed from a sheep farm to a thriving vineyard ecosystem, and certified biodynamic since 1996. The McNab single-vineyard bottling assembles the best reds from this historic site into a Cabernet Sauvignon-driven blend.

For the 2020 vintage, winter was relatively dry, only bringing about half the amount of rain of an average season. Spring did experience more frost days than a typical season, but with a mild to moderate overall temperatures, bud break and flowering occurred about a week earlier than 2019. The yields of a lot of varietals were lower than normal yields. August and September were warm, bringing a few heat spikes into the region which sped up harvest by a couple of weeks from the average harvest season. Smaller than normal berry size resulted in increased phenolic content and concentration of flavors.

The fruit for this blend was harvested by hand at optimal ripeness over several weeks. Select vineyard blocks and varieties were fermented separately in stainless steel tanks for 10 to 14 days, with only the finest lots selected for this cuvée. The wine aged for 14 months in 25% percent new French oak barrels with a medium toast, before the final blend was assembled.

Density: 600-1200 Vines/Acre
Age Of Vines: 15-40 Years
Appellation: Mendocino County
Vineyard: Mcnab Ranch Vineyard

Varietal Content:
Cabernet Sauvignon 80%
Petite Sirah 20%

Cases Produced: 2,000
Alcohol 14.2%
Ta g/100mL: 6
pH: 3.65
